  • 101 reasons to go to the next PropertyTalk event near you

    In December (I think) last year I finally got off my arse and went to my first PT event / meet. Including today's one with Dean I've now attanded 4 and it gets better and better every time.

    Here's a few great reasons everyone out there should get involved (ok, so there's not really 101, but I reckon there would be if everyone else put theirs in too):
    • You get to meet high flyers like Dean Letfus for free
    • It costs you a bit of time, a coffee, or maybe a dinner. You get a hell of a lot more in return
    • You get to meet a lot of people who are doing the same as you or struggling with the same issues as you. What better opportunity to pick up new ideas or just get the support and reassuarance you are doing the right thing
    • It's free
    • You can almost guarantee to meet someone new and learn something new every time
    • It's free
    • You can get a lot more in a short time by talking to other people than by sitting here in front of the computer
    • It's free
    • You can help others. Everyone has different areas of knowledge and speciality. Share yours to help other people learn
    • Did I mention it's free?
    If you are like me and it takes a while to build up momentum towards your goals then get out there and talk to other supportive people about it. It really does make a difference.
